CommonTypesMath

Library "CommonTypesMath"
Provides a common library source for common types of useful mathematical structures.
Includes: `complex, Vector2, Vector3, Vector4, Quaternion, Segment2, Segment3, Pole, Plane, M32, M44`
complex
Representation of a Complex Number, a complex number `z` is a number in the form `z = x + yi`,
Fields:
re: Real part of the complex number.
im: Imaginary part of the complex number.
Vector2
Representation of a two dimentional vector with components `(x:float,y:float)`.
Fields:
x: Coordinate `x` of the vector.
y: Coordinate `y` of the vector.
Vector3
Representation of a three dimentional vector with components `(x:float,y:float,z:float)`.
Fields:
x: Coordinate `x` of the vector.
y: Coordinate `y` of the vector.
z: Coordinate `z` of the vector.
Vector4
Representation of a four dimentional vector with components `(x:float,y:float,z:float,w:float)`.
Fields:
x: Coordinate `x` of the vector.
y: Coordinate `y` of the vector.
z: Coordinate `z` of the vector.
w: Coordinate `w` of the vector.
Quaternion
Representation of a four dimentional vector with components `(x:float,y:float,z:float,w:float)`.
Fields:
x: Coordinate `x` of the vector.
y: Coordinate `y` of the vector.
z: Coordinate `z` of the vector.
w: Coordinate `w` of the vector, specifies the rotation component.
Segment2
Representation of a line in two dimentional space.
Fields:
origin: Origin coordinates.
target: Target coordinates.
Segment3
Representation of a line in three dimentional space.
Fields:
origin: Origin coordinates.
target: Target coordinates.
Pole
Representation of polar coordinates `(radius:float,angle:float)`.
Fields:
radius: Radius of the pole.
angle: Angle in radians of the pole.
Plane
Representation of a 3D plane.
Fields:
normal: Normal vector of the plane.
distance: Distance of the plane along its normal from the origin.
M32
Representation of a 3x2 matrix.
Fields:
m11: First element of the first row.
m12: Second element of the first row.
m21: First element of the second row.
m22: Second element of the second row.
m31: First element of the third row.
m32: Second element of the third row.
M44
Representation of a 4x4 matrix.
Fields:
m11: First element of the first row.
m12: Second element of the first row.
m13: Third element of the first row.
m14: fourth element of the first row.
m21: First element of the second row.
m22: Second element of the second row.
m23: Third element of the second row.
m24: fourth element of the second row.
m31: First element of the third row.
m32: Second element of the third row.
m33: Third element of the third row.
m34: fourth element of the third row.
m41: First element of the fourth row.
m42: Second element of the fourth row.
m43: Third element of the fourth row.
m44: fourth element of the fourth row.
